По состоянию на сегодняшний день спецификация HTML5 существует в виде рабочего проекта (Working Draft) и еще далека до завершения. Так когда же можно ожидать появления ее окончательного варианта? Вот некоторые ключевые даты, о которых вам будет нелишне знать. Первая из них— это 2012 год, на который запланирован выпуск возможной рекомендации (Candidate Recommendation).
Вторая опорная точка— 2022 год, когда должна выйти предлагаемая рекомендация (Proposed Recommendation). Постойте-ка, не торопитесь! Не спешите захлопывать книгу, откладывая ее в сторону на 10 лет, чтобы она дожидалась своего часа, пока до конца не разберетесь, что на самом деле означают эти даты.
Пожалуй, более важной для нас является первая из указанных дат, она же и ближайшая, поскольку к этому времени спецификация HTML5 должна быть окончательно сформулирована, и тогда можно будет считать, что стандарт как таковой готов. Это произойдет примерно через два года. Важность же утверждения спецификации в статусе предлагаемой рекомендации (а этот момент наступит, с чем все мы согласимся, довольно не скоро) заключается в том, что к тому времени браузеры, как предполагается, будут предоставлять полную поддержку всех возможностей языка — благородная цель, достижение которой к 2022 году представляется довольно амбициозной задачей. Ведь если говорить честно, то в случае спецификации HTML 4 мы к этому даже не приблизились.
Действительно важным для нас является тот факт, что в настоящее время производители браузеров активно внедряют поддержку многих новых возможностей. В зависимости от того, какова ваша аудитория, вы можете использовать эти возможности уже сегодня. Несомненно, со временем придется то и дело вносить некоторые незначительные поправки, но это совсем небольшая плата за те преимущества, которые сулит доступ к передовым технологиям. Конечно, если большая часть вашей аудитории все еще пользуется браузером Internet Explorer 6.0, то многие из новейших средств не будут работать, и их придется эмулировать, однако это не является веским аргументом в пользу того, чтобы отказываться от HTML5. Ведь рано или поздно такие пользователи все равно перейдут к более новым версиям программ. Вполне возможно, что многие из них уже сейчас предпочтут установить у себя Internet Explorer 9.0, тем более что корпорация Microsoft обещает усиленную поддержку HTML5 в этой версии своего браузер». С практической точки зрения новые браузеры в сочетании с усовершенствованными технологиями эмуляции позволяют использовать многие средства HTML5 уже сегодня или, по крайней мере, в ближайшем будущем.